Vollie Q&A – Genty

6 May 2024

Name: Genty Ginn
Role: Information Desk
What’s your background: I grew up in Atherton. With my late husband’s work we were transferred around Australia. Our last posting was Melbourne. I have been back in Cairns for 13 years.
When and why did you join the Foundation’s team: I have been back in B Block information desk for 12 years. I became a volunteer through my neighbour many years ago.
Star sign: Taurus
Family: I have two sons and three granddaughters.
Interests: Walking, shopping, going to live shows at CPAC. I am also involved with the Salvation Army. We have a ladies group who meet once a week. At Christmas time we help pack hamper packs for the people who need help.
What do you enjoy about your role here: I enjoy the friendship and the smiles of people when you are able to help them. I always hve a laugh when people ask me if they could have my purple turbans!
